Shower Valve Repair in Denver, CO
Shower valve repair services focus on diagnosing and fixing issues with the valve that controls water flow and temperature in a shower. These repairs can address a variety of problems, including leaks, inconsistent water temperature, low water pressure, or difficulty adjusting the shower controls. Projects may involve replacing worn-out or damaged valve components, repairing internal mechanisms, or upgrading outdated valves to improve functionality and prevent future issues. Common Shower Valve Repair Jobs
Shower valve replacement - upgrading outdated or faulty valves to improve shower performance.
Leak repairs - fixing dripping or leaking shower valves to prevent water waste and damage.
Valve cartridge replacement - restoring proper function by replacing worn or broken cartridges inside the valve.
Temperature control fixes - repairing issues with inconsistent or unsafe water temperature.
Pressure balancing valve services - ensuring balanced water pressure for a comfortable shower experience.
Complete valve repairs - addressing complex issues to restore full operation of the shower valve system.
Shower Valve Repair Questions
What are common signs of a faulty shower valve? Leaking, inconsistent water temperature, or low water pressure often indicate issues with the shower valve.
Can a shower valve be repaired instead of replaced? Yes, many shower valve problems can be fixed through repair, avoiding the need for full replacement.
What types of shower valves might need repair? Cartridge, pressure-balance, and thermostatic valves are common types that may require repair services.
Why is it important to address shower valve issues promptly? Timely repairs prevent water damage, improve shower performance, and avoid more costly repairs later.
